The Rimberg transmitter is a Hessian broadcasting system for VHF , DVB-T , mobile radio and radio relay on the Rimberg in the Hersfeld-Rotenburg district of Hesse .

The transmitter was built in 1966 and uses a 220-meter-high guyed steel truss mast with a square cross-section. Until the switch to DVB-T on May 29, 2006, analog television was broadcast on channels 25 ( ZDF , 250 kW), 39 ( HR , 332 kW) and 57 ( ARD , 400 kW).

On May 1 and 2, 2018, the more than 50-year-old GRP cylinder was replaced with a new one. The new tip contains the antennas for DVB-T2 .

Geographical location

The Rimberg transmitter is located on the Rimberg ( 591.8  m above sea  level ), a wooded mountain in the Knüll low mountain range between the towns of Alsfeld and Bad Hersfeld . It is located about 500 meters east, above the at the National Highway 5 standing motel locking house Rimberg (about  484  m ) in the northwest part of the elongated ridge.

The programs broadcast on the Rimberg station were partially changed in 2005 after several decades. First of all, the radio youth wave You FM was activated in April on the frequency 97.7 used by hr3 up to then. In the course of a larger, Hesse-wide frequency swap between Hessischer Rundfunk and Deutschlandradio, the Deutschlandfunk program has been broadcast on the 91.3 MHz frequency since June 2005. Previously, hr1 could be heard here.

In February 2013, the hr-info program was activated on the 95.0 MHz frequency previously used by hr2.

Today, hr1, hr2 and hr3 can only be heard in the coverage area of ​​the Rimberg transmitter via neighboring transmitter locations (especially Hoher Meißner , Heidelstein and Sackpfeife ).

Digital radio (DAB)

DAB is broadcast in vertical polarization and in single-frequency mode with other transmitters. The activation of DAB channel 7B, the state-wide multiplex of the Hessischer Rundfunk and the nationwide multiplex on DAB channel 5C took place on August 1, 2012.

Digital television (DVB-T2)

On March 29, 2017, the broadcasting of DVB-T programs ended and regular operation of DVB-T2 HD began. Since then send in the DVB-T2 standard, the programs of the ARD ( hr mux) and the ZDF in HEVC -Videokodierverfahren and in Full HD resolution.

The DVB-T2 HD -Ausstrahlungen from Rimberg are partly in simulcast (Single Frequency Network) with other transmitter sites.
